技术文摘
如何使用Mysql管理关系型数据库
如何使用Mysql管理关系型数据库
在当今数字化时代,数据的有效管理至关重要,而关系型数据库是众多数据管理方式中的重要选择。Mysql作为一款广泛使用的开源关系型数据库管理系统,掌握其使用方法对于数据管理工作者和开发者意义重大。
首先是安装与配置。从Mysql官方网站下载适合操作系统的安装包,安装过程中需注意设置root用户密码等关键参数。安装完成后,可通过修改配置文件(如my.cnf或my.ini)来优化数据库性能,如调整内存分配、字符编码等参数。
创建数据库和表是基础操作。使用“CREATE DATABASE”语句可创建新的数据库,例如“CREATE DATABASE mydb;”。创建表则使用“CREATE TABLE”语句,同时要定义表的列名、数据类型和约束条件,像“CREATE TABLE users (id INT PRIMARY KEY AUTO_INCREMENT, name VARCHAR(50), age INT);” 便创建了一个名为users的表。
数据的增删改查是日常管理的核心。插入数据使用“INSERT INTO”语句,如“INSERT INTO users (name, age) VALUES ('张三', 25);”。查询数据用“SELECT”语句,“SELECT * FROM users;”可查询users表中的所有数据,还能通过条件筛选,如“SELECT * FROM users WHERE age > 30;”。更新数据使用“UPDATE”语句,“UPDATE users SET age = 26 WHERE name = '张三';” 能修改指定记录。删除数据则用“DELETE FROM”语句,“DELETE FROM users WHERE id = 1;” 可删除特定记录。
索引的合理使用能大幅提升查询效率。可使用“CREATE INDEX”语句创建索引,例如“CREATE INDEX idx_name ON users (name);” 为users表的name列创建索引。
备份与恢复也是重要环节。通过命令行工具mysqldump可进行备份,如“mysqldump -u root -p mydb > mydb_backup.sql” 能备份数据库mydb。恢复时,先创建空数据库,再使用“mysql -u root -p mydb < mydb_backup.sql” 导入备份文件。
掌握Mysql管理关系型数据库的方法,能高效处理数据,为企业的信息化建设和数据驱动决策提供有力支持。无论是小型项目还是大型企业级应用,熟练运用Mysql都能让数据管理工作更加顺畅和高效。
- 探索 CSS 框架
- div如何居中
- Sista AI的React AI ChatBot助力解锁智能对话
- TypeScript简介
- JavaScript函数式编程简介之Monoid、Applicatives与Lenses #8
- Cypress 自定义命令最佳实践详细指南
- 基于 MongoDB、Django、Celery 与 Sendgrid 搭建批量通知系统
- JavaScript中三元运算符ES6的短路情况
- 深入探索 CSS 盒模型:全面指南
- 探秘电波暗室:揭开无声的神秘面纱
- 设计模式之适配器模式
- 借助Vue Composition API构建可扩展且可维护的代码库
- TypeScript 字符串压缩编码历程
- 鲜为人知的 Javascript 功能,您可能从未用过
- Typescript编码纪事:计算除Self外数组元素的乘积